Mô tả sản phẩm
Excellent Adhesion Water Based Acrylic Emulsion With Good Wear Resistance
WQ-293 is a high-TG waterborne acrylic film-forming emulsion with narrow particle size distribution and excellent adhesion. This advanced formulation features low foaming, excellent flowability, high gloss, good wear resistance, fast drying, low odor, and superior compatibility with waterborne acrylic resins and emulsions.
Physical Properties
Properties Units Values
Appearance --- Milky white liquid with a bluish tint
Viscosity (25℃) cps 1100-2500
Solid Content % 46±1
pH --- 7.5-8.5
Tg 105
Performance Features
  • Excellent wettability and dispersibility
  • Good printing stability
  • Compatible with popular water-based resins in the market
  • Low odor formulation
